isn't this 'Sound of..' poll just who the BBC and the record labels have decided we should be sold this year? "this years style for the kids will be female pop (again), they'll buy it"

i haven't heard Jessie J, but after Florence and her Machine and Ellie Goulding in recent years they can keep it tbh.

Florence didn't win it. Little Boots won it the year Florence came third. White Lies were seocnd. Funnily enough Mumford and Sons didn't make the top 5 that year. Sadly something went drasticlly wrong when Little Boots made her album and the direction, marketing and single releases were just awful. Shame as the album is brilliant in places.

That year goes to show that the list doesn't really reflect record sales.

It is a bit of a joke though and does seem to always pick a solo female artist. Adele was a good shout though.
